Foldable basketball stand
A foldable basketball stand has at least one first hoop on a rear end surface of a backboard on an upper half portion of a front frame. A middle portion of first left/right rod of the front frame has two first left/right joints respectively. One end and the other end of left top/bottom rod of a left frame are connected to a left-rear rod/the first left rod respectively. One end and the other end of right top/bottom rod of a right frame are connected to a right-rear rod/the first right rod respectively. A middle portion of left/right rear rod has first/second rear joints respectively. An upper half portion of a rear frame has a stop portion. Left/right sides of the rear frame are connected to left/right rear rods through left/right connecting rods respectively.
TWO PLAYER DOOR COURT
A basketball return chute assembly includes a chute and a backboard attachment device. The chute is adapted to receive a ball from a basketball basket assembly attached to a backboard and direct the received ball back to a game player. The backboard attachment device is connected to the chute and is adapted to attach to the backboard, to place the chute beneath the basket assembly, and to cause the chute to direct the received ball in a direction away from the backboard. The backboard attachment device is connected to the chute via a hinge. The chute includes a slide with a knuckle at one end and the backboard attachment device includes a plate with another knuckle at one end. The slide is one leaf of the hinge, and the plate is the other leaf of the hinge. The hinge is held together using a pin inserted through the knuckles.

Basketball return backstop net with angular adjustability
A freestanding basketball backstop assembly returns basketballs shot at a basketball hoop to a player positioned at a location spaced apart from the basketball hoop. A net support has a base and side legs, with vertical rods removably insertable into sockets of the side legs and threaded through sleeves extending from the side edges of the net peripheral border. The base is placed in front of the post supporting the basketball backboard. In one embodiment, the net is arranged behind the post supporting the backboard, and a slit opening in the bottom periphery of the net receives a portion of the post supporting the backboard. In other embodiments, the net remains in front of the post supporting the backboard, and the vertical rods are set variably to place the net in different angle orientations so that the assembly may be used either as a backstop assembly, or as a defender barrier in front of the basketball basket or as a barrier or practice net for other sports.
Blow molded part including compression molded element
In one example, a structure is provided that includes a plastic body having a unitary, single-piece construction. The plastic body further includes a substantially hollow interior, and a parting line that extends around a portion of the perimeter of the structure. The structure also includes a solid compression molded element that is integral with the plastic body. The solid compression molded element is configured and arranged such that the parting line is not connected to the solid compression molded element.
APPARATUS AND METHOD OF USING A GAME APPARATUS FOR BOUNCING PROJECTILES
A game apparatus includes an elastic material secured and stretched onto a chassis to create a material surface. The material surface receives a thrown projectile and bounces the projectile from the surface. The material surface faces players at an angle to return or project objects thrown at it. In use, the stretched surface is generally at an angle between 25 to 40 degrees from parallel with a playing surface. A player stands or sits in close proximity to the game apparatus and tosses a lightweight object at the stretched surface. The height and tension of the stretched surface are generally fixed to produce consistent bounce back results. The game apparatus is a toy for a tabletop space or oversized for floor or lawn use. The game apparatus and accessories (including mats, trays, cups, spiked balls and coins) may be used in family, pub, cafe and outdoor environments.
METHODS, APPARATUSES, AND KITS FOR FACILITATING A GAMEPLAY
Disclosed herein is a game apparatus for facilitating a gameplay by disposing the game apparatus on a surface, in accordance with some embodiments. Accordingly, the game apparatus comprises a panel and a kickstand. Further, a right panel and a left panel of the panel are rotatable for transitioning the panel between a folded position and an extended position. Further, a front surface of the panel forms a playing surface in the extended position. Further, the kickstand is attached to a rear surface of the panel. Further, the kickstand is rotatable for transitioning the kickstand between a close stand position and an open stand position. Further, the kickstand is configured for inclinably supporting the panel on the surface with an inclination in the open stand position. Further, disposing and the inclinably supporting of the panel on the surface in the extended position allows striking of an object on the playing surface.
COLUMN CONFIGURATION FOR SPORTING EQUIPMENT
A portable sporting equipment assembly including a column removably attachable to a base. The column can include a tapered foundation and can be inserted through a bottom of the base. The base includes an opening with a taper that is complimentary to the tapered foundation of the column. One or more horizontal notches can secure the tapered foundation of the column into the base when engaged with one or more horizontal recessions of the opening of the base. The tapered foundation can reduce strain at an interface between the column and the base.
